Output d4e5a01720d121f3f925384f449461f3febbe14a314ea2976dbdc4e5d748c7bf:40

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cae76a1f44e7271ac40c7652cfcf3193fa6df50 OP_EQUAL
address
34JfqqyMfBRx1XXHczM8kp4U8HMSnJpYYa
transaction
d4e5a01720d121f3f925384f449461f3febbe14a314ea2976dbdc4e5d748c7bf